By incorporating the design concept of multiple excitations and stator-partitioned structure into the FSPM motor, a new hybrid excited stator-partitioned flux switching permanent magnet motor (HESP-FSPM) is proposed in this paper. On the one hand, by using hybrid permanent magnet (PM), the volume of rare-earth PMs in the proposed machine is reduced effectively with relatively high torque capability...
A less rare-earth double-stator flux-switching permanent magnet (LR-DSFSPM) motor is proposed in this paper, in which the permanent magnets (PMs) and windings are all located in the inner and outer stator, resulting in a simple and robust rotor structure. By adopting V-shaped ferrite PMs in the outer stator, an enhanced flux-focusing effect can be obtained in the outer motor, contributing to obtaining...
